Before booking, check destination-specific official guidance for safety, entry requirements, visa rules and local restrictions.
Security queues, check-in, baggage handling and airline schedule changes can all affect travel. Arrive early and check your airline's latest instructions.
Many destinations require minimum passport validity and may require visas or electronic travel authorisations. Requirements can differ by nationality and transit route.
Keep secure digital and physical copies of passports, visas, insurance, booking confirmations and emergency contact details.
Arrange insurance as early as possible. Check that it covers medical costs, cancellation, missed departure, baggage and the activities you plan to do.
Visa and entry requirements can depend on nationality, destination, transit country and travel purpose. Check before paying for non-refundable travel.
Airlines, hotels and transfer companies can have strict cancellation, amendment and refund rules. Read supplier terms before confirming.
Names should match passports exactly. Name corrections can be expensive or impossible once tickets are issued.
Speak to a GP, pharmacist or travel clinic where health requirements, vaccines or medication may be relevant for your destination.
Save airline, insurer, accommodation and local emergency contact details before departure.
